Psychometric testingPsychometric testing is versatile and can be used as an aid for personnel selection and recruitment, career guidance, career development, team building and personal development. Used correctly, it can improve the match between employer and employee. Most tests take in the region of 30 minutes each, with the exception of the Morrisby Profile, which (because it is a battery of 12 tests) takes just over 3 hours in total. Psychometric testing can provide information on a candidate's relative strengths, personality profile, motivation, likely team role behaviour (Belbin) and many other characteristics - more rapidly and reliably than extensive interviewing. When making selection decisions, psychometric testing should be used as one of many sources of information, such as career history, qualifications, CVs and application forms. Research shows that the use of psychometric testing can significantly improve the match between the employer and the employee. In certain circumstances, these benefits can be improved even further when testing is used as part of a correctly designed and administered Assessment Centre. Psychometric testing is used by an increasing number of large and small companies who appreciate its cost effectiveness when compared to the hard, soft and human costs of selection errors. |
